Output d3c21754a1eaf95cffae716b0287d8fbe1c8ed91f56275258440d7f2d0906488:27

value
122531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0204044227c544b1a32bf1aad24f07ab9341454 OP_EQUAL
address
3GHgg5V7qNdha4977LttKMVqYiU14zBTnN
transaction
d3c21754a1eaf95cffae716b0287d8fbe1c8ed91f56275258440d7f2d0906488
spent
true